I've been trying to use a Shib-enabled SP, and I've been having some 
problems. I'm wondering if this group might provide some "best practice" 
info addressing some of the issues that I encountered. I'd prefer to not 
identify the site. Rather, I think the problems I encountered may be 
evident on lots of sites, and are more general than just this one site.

I went to the public front page, and clicked a button. This transferred 
me to a variation of the Discovery Service implementation provided by 
the Shib project. I selected my campus, and was transferred to my IDP. 
(Note -- my login page did display the Description text for this SP; 
however, the logo url in the metadata element for this SP was stale.)

I was then presented with an error page:

 > There seems to be a problem with your account.
 > We have not received your email address from your identity provider 
(IdP). This might be because your home organization IdP is not releasing
your email address.
 > Please see your home organization's IdP administrator. See our
Attribute Release Policy for more information.

I'd like to identify some of the issues I encountered, and see if there 
are suggestions:

1) This site is a member of InCommon, and is clearly supporting Higher 
Ed Identity issues, but for unknown reasons this is NOT an R&S site. If 
it were, my IDP would have released the desired attributes.

2) This seems to be a "big" SP hosting many services, which may explain 
why no R&S. I'm told that all of the services require the same 
attributes, tho. What might prevent this site from being tagged as R&S ?

3) There was no indication up front during the Login process that 
attributes are requested or required. Where should that have been done ?

4) There was no indication of the SP's entityID value. My IDP admin 
needs that value in order to construct an Attribute Release Filter.

5) The site did not follow InCommon's recommended error handling 
recommendations:

https://spaces.internet2.edu/display/InCFederation/Federated+Error+Handling

Instead, I was presented with this page containing this text:

     We have not received your email address from your identity provider 
(IdP). This might be because your home organization IdP is not releasing 
your email address.

Interestingly, this text does not agree with the RequestedAttribute 
elements in the metadata entry.

6) That error page contains a dead link to attribute policy.

     We're sorry. It appears that something has broken on our system. 
Don't worry, the web support team has been notified and will fix this 
issue as soon as possible.

7) If I retry the whole process, I am immediately redirected to the main 
web page for the site. No Discovery Service, no IDP. I understand that. 
But, instead of seeing an error, I'm redirected to a useless url.

What should it do ?
